一种用于直接转矩控制高性能内嵌式永磁交流驱动器的逆变器非线性独立磁链观测器

An Inverter Nonlinearity-Independent Flux Observer for Direct Torque-Controlled High-Performance Interior Permanent Magnet Brushless AC Drives

中文摘要

本文提出了一种新型磁链观测器,适用于宽转速范围(含零速)下的直接转矩控制内嵌式永磁交流驱动器。该观测器考虑了电机非线性,且在稳态下不受逆变器非线性、死区效应及电枢电阻变化的影响,通过测量值快速补偿上述误差。

English Abstract

This paper introduces a novel flux observer for direct torque controlled interior permanent magnet brushless AC (IPM-BLAC) drives over a wide speed range including standstill. The observer takes machine nonlinearities into account and is independent of inverter nonlinearities, dead time, and armature resistance variation at steady states since such inaccuracies are compensated quickly by measured ...
